
Carmen Electra has opened up once again about one of the most talked-about relationships of the 1990s: her brief marriage to former NBA star Dennis Rodman, which lasted only nine days before he filed for an annulment.
The two met in 1998 and got married in Las Vegas on November 14 of that year. However, the marriage was annulled just a few days later, on November 23.
The actress explained that although the romance was intense and full of passion, it was marked by a chaotic lifestyle alongside Rodman, particularly due to constant partying and excessive alcohol consumption. “There was a lot of drinking,” she said in a recent interview on the Legally Goff podcast.
“And I just remember looking at myself in the mirror. I was at home and I didn’t recognize myself. I had bags under my eyes. My face was swollen. And I was in my twenties, you know, and I thought I had to stop. It had to stop,” added the Baywatch actress.

After the separation, Electra married guitarist Dave Navarro in 2003. The couple announced their separation in 2006 and finalized their divorce the following year, in 2007. Their relationship was even documented in the reality show Till Death Do Us Part: Carmen and Dave, which aired on MTV in 2004.
